excel怎么填充单元格的后面一半

excel怎么填充单元格的后面一半

在Excel中填充单元格的后面一半,可以通过条件格式、使用公式、创建自定义格式等方式实现。 其中,条件格式使用公式是最常见且灵活的方式。下面将详细介绍如何使用这些方法来实现这一目标。


一、条件格式

1.1 创建数据条

条件格式中的数据条功能可以实现单元格部分填充。下面是具体步骤:

  1. 选中需要填充的单元格或区域。
  2. 点击“开始”选项卡中的“条件格式”按钮。
  3. 选择“数据条”。
  4. 选择一种填充颜色。

1.2 使用公式进行条件格式

  1. 选中需要填充的单元格或区域。
  2. 点击“条件格式” -> “新建规则”。
  3. 选择“使用公式确定要设置格式的单元格”。
  4. 输入公式,例如 =MOD(ROW(),2)=0 用于填充偶数行。
  5. 点击“格式”,选择填充颜色。

二、使用公式

2.1 合并单元格与填充

  1. 选中需要填充的单元格范围。
  2. 点击“合并后居中”按钮。
  3. 在合并后的单元格中输入数据,利用格式工具填充。

2.2 使用重复函数

  1. 在目标单元格中输入数据,例如在A1中输入“测试”。
  2. 在B1中输入公式 =REPT(" ", LEN(A1)/2)&A1,实现将数据填充到单元格的后半部分。

三、自定义格式

3.1 创建自定义单元格格式

  1. 选中需要填充的单元格或区域。
  2. 点击右键,选择“设置单元格格式”。
  3. 选择“自定义”。
  4. 输入自定义格式代码,例如 * 空格 实现填充。

3.2 使用格式代码进行填充

  1. 选中目标单元格。
  2. 输入数据,例如“12345”。
  3. 设置自定义格式代码如 12345*
  4. 实现单元格后半部分填充效果。

四、使用VBA宏

4.1 创建VBA宏

  1. 按Alt + F11打开VBA编辑器。
  2. 插入一个新模块。
  3. 输入以下代码:

Sub FillRightHalf()

Dim rng As Range

Set rng = Selection

For Each cell In rng

cell.Value = cell.Value & String(Len(cell.Value) / 2, " ")

Next cell

End Sub

  1. 运行宏,实现单元格后半部分填充。

4.2 调整VBA代码

根据需要调整VBA代码,以实现更复杂的填充效果。例如:

Sub FillRightHalfWithColor()

Dim rng As Range

Set rng = Selection

For Each cell In rng

cell.Value = cell.Value & String(Len(cell.Value) / 2, " ")

cell.Interior.Color = RGB(255, 0, 0) ' 填充红色

Next cell

End Sub


通过上述方法,可以在Excel中实现单元格后半部分的填充。每种方法都有其特点和适用场景,可以根据实际需求选择合适的方法。无论是通过条件格式、公式、自定义格式还是VBA宏,都可以灵活地实现这一目标。

相关问答FAQs:

1. 我想在Excel中填充单元格的后半部分,应该怎么做?

要在Excel中填充单元格的后半部分,可以使用合并单元格的功能。首先,选择需要填充的单元格,然后点击“开始”选项卡上的“合并和居中”按钮。接下来,选择“合并单元格”选项,然后选择“向下合并”或“向右合并”,具体取决于您想要填充的方向。这样,单元格的后半部分将被填充。

2. 如何在Excel表格中实现单元格的后半部分填充效果?

要在Excel表格中实现单元格的后半部分填充效果,您可以使用条件格式功能。首先,选择需要填充的单元格,然后在“开始”选项卡上点击“条件格式”按钮。接下来,选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。在公式框中输入条件,例如“=COLUMN()>列数/2”,其中“列数”是您表格中的总列数。然后选择要应用的格式,例如填充颜色。点击“确定”后,所选单元格的后半部分将会被填充。

3. 我想在Excel中使用渐变效果填充单元格的后半部分,应该怎么做?

要在Excel中使用渐变效果填充单元格的后半部分,可以使用条件格式功能。首先,选择需要填充的单元格,然后在“开始”选项卡上点击“条件格式”按钮。接下来,选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。在公式框中输入条件,例如“=COLUMN()>列数/2”,其中“列数”是您表格中的总列数。然后选择要应用的格式,例如渐变填充。点击“确定”后,所选单元格的后半部分将会呈现出渐变的填充效果。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4736616

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部